Transport Options
Traveling from Maceió to Salvador, approximately 485 km apart, offers several convenient transportation options. The quickest choice is a flight, taking around 1 hour, ideal for travelers looking to save time. Alternatively, a bus journey lasts about 7 to 8 hours, providing a scenic and budget-friendly option for those who prefer a relaxed travel experience. For those who enjoy driving, renting a car allows for flexibility and exploration along the way, with a travel time of about 6 hours. Each mode caters to different preferences, making it easy for every type of traveler to find a suitable option.
